mpjegtools fails to build on powerpc without altivec:

build_sub44_mests.c: In function 'build_sub44_mests_altivec':
build_sub44_mests.c:268:9: internal compiler error: Segmentation fault
     vr1 = vec_ld(rowstride, (unsigned char*)s44blk);

It seems mpjegtools is wrongly detecting altivec support:
configure:   - PowerPC Optimizations:
configure:     - AltiVec enabled             : true

Fix this by adding BR2_PACKAGE_MJPEGTOOLS_SIMD_SUPPORT and setting
--enable-simd-accel / --disable-simd-accel

The check-package script when ran gives warnings on ordering issues
on all of these Config files.  This patch cleans up all warnings
related to the ordering in the Config files for packages starting with
the letter m in the package directory.

The appropriate ordering is: type, default, depends on, select, help

We want to use SPDX identifier for license strings as much as possible.
SPDX short identifier for GPLv2/GPLv2+ is GPL-2.0/GPL-2.0+.

This change is done by using following command.
find . -name "*.mk" | xargs sed -ri '/LICENSE( )?[\+:]?=/s/\&lt;GPLv2\&gt;/GPL-2.0/g'

The mjpegtools programs are a set of tools that can do recording of videos
and playback, simple cut-and-paste editing and the MPEG compression of audio
and video under Linux.
